Jewish Calendar 101

April - June 2024 | Nissan - Sivan 5784*

* Holidays begin at sundown on the evening before, concluding at sundown on noted day.

Pesach (Passover )

The Holiday of Our Freedom

April 23-30 | 15-22 Nissan

Pesach is the celebration of the Exodus from Egypt; our journey from a narrow place of slavery to freedom. The week-long holiday begins with a Seder (order) meal with foods that symbolize this journey, accompanied by the retelling of the exodus story.

Yom HaAtzmaut

Israel’s Independence Day

May 14 | 6 Iyar

This date celebrates the anniversary of Israel’s independence. It was proclaimed when David Ben-Gurion – the de facto leader of the Jewish community – read the declaration of independence.

Lag BaOmer

33rd Day of Counting of the Omer

Counting of the Omer

Sefirat HaOmer

April 23-June 11 | 15 Nissan-5 Sivan

We count the 49 days between Pesach and Shavuot because it took seven weeks to reach Mount Sinai and receive the Torah. Each day of the Counting of the Omer represents spiritual preparation in anticipation of receiving the Torah.

Yom HaShoah

Holocaust Remembrance Day

May 6 | 28 Nissan

This year, Yom HaShoah begins at sundown on Monday, April 17 and ends at nightfall on Tuesday, April 18. We commemorate the approximately six million Jews and others who perished in the Holocaust due to Nazi Germany. For ceremony details visit jewishcalgary.org.

Yom HaZikaron

Israel’s Memorial Day

May 13 | 5 Iyar

This year, Yom HaZikaron begins at sundown on Monday, April 24 and ends at nightfall on Tuesday, April 25. Israel dedicates this day of remembrance to those who have fallen in defence of the State of Israel and to the victims of terror.

May 26 | 18 Iyar

This holiday commemorates the passing of the great sage Rabbi Shimon bar Yochai, author of the kabbalistic book the Zohar (Book of Splendor), a landmark text of Jewish mysticism. It’s tradition on this day to have picnics and light bonfires.

Yom Yerushalayim

Jerusalem Day

June 5 | 28 Iyar

National Israeli holiday commemorating the reunification of Jerusalem and the establishment of Israeli control over the Old City in the aftermath of the June 1967 Six-Day War.

Shavuot

The Feast of Weeks

June 12-13 | 6-7 Sivan

A doubly significant holiday marking Israel’s wheat harvest, as well as commemorating when the Torah was given to the nation of Israel at Mount Sinai.

Sources: myjewishlearning.org chabad.org

Pool Rules

AQUATICS

1 . Any children seven years of age or younger must be within arm’s reach of an adult 16 years of age or older, and the parent / guardian MUST be in the water No swim tests are allowed until child is eight years old

2 Anybody eight years and older who shows signs of weak swimming may be asked to use a lifejacket or can challenge the swim test If the swim test is completed then no lifejacket and no adult supervision is required . If the swim test is not passed, patron must wear a lifejacket

Swim Test (as recommended by the Lifesaving Society):

Sixty seconds treading water with head fully out of the water, immediately followed by 25 meters swim without stopping

One long, loud whistle blast means clear the pool.

Please note:

• Must take a head to toe shower with soap before entering the pool

• Consult and get permission from your doctor if you have a medical condition, are pregnant or are 65+ years .

• Max . of three children under 8 years may be supervised by one caregiver, 16+ years .

• No urinating in or fouling the pool

• Children 0-2 years and anyone incontinent must wear a swim diaper and waterproof pool pants

• No diving in shallow end .

• No outdoor shoes .

• No glass, food, gum or drink

• No running, rough play, offensive behaviour or foul language

Do not use pool if you:

• Have been told not to by a regional health authority or doctor

• Have diarrhea or have had diarrhea in the past two weeks .

• Have an infectious or communicable disease, sores, and / or wounds .

• Are under the influence of drugs or alcohol

IF YOU FEEL DIZZINESS, FATIGUE, HEADACHE, OR NAUSEA LEAVE THE POOL IMMEDIATELY AND FIND ASSISTANCE

Bronze Medallion/CPR C Ages 13+

Challenges participants both mentally and physically Judgment, knowledge, skill, and fitness – the four components of water rescue – form the basis of Bronze Medallion training Participants acquire the assessment and problem-solving skills needed to make good decisions in, on, and around the water Bronze Medallion is a prerequisite for assistant lifeguard training in Bronze Cross Prerequisite: Minimum 13 years of age or Bronze Star certification (need not be current).

Intermediate Ages 12+ First Aid / CPR

By taking intermediate first aid and CPR training, candidates will become part of the chain of survival, and will learn the most up-to-date CPR training This two-day, Occupational Health and Safety (OH&S) approved course covers a range of first aid topics and certifies candidates in CPR level C with AED training Once a candidate successfully completes the skills component and multiple choice exam (with minimum grade of 75%) they will immediately receive a workplace approved first aid and CPR certificate valid for three years

Aqua Fitness

We offer a large selection of aqua fitness classes FREE to our members The general public may pay a drop-in fee (see page 9) to attend the class . Experience a fitness class in the pool! Water has a thousand times more resistance to that of air so it can provide an awesome workout . It is suitable for everyone as all movements use the body’s own resistance

Our aqua fitness classes are 50 minutes in length and are led by a team of highlyqualified instructors The components of all fitness classes include: a warm up, cardiovascular conditioning, muscle and core strengthening, and stretching . There is an average of 16 aqua fitness classes that run weekly They vary in intensity and fitness level so as to meet the needs and abilities of all our adult and older members

Aqua Variety

A challenging class offering a variety of formats and styles from week to week This class will rotate from equipment use classes to interval training, tether and a taste of aqua healing

Aqua Zen

A shallow water aquafit experience that encourages peace and vitality through a variety of movements that inspires harmony within the mind, body and spirit . This holistic, wellness-based class focuses on mindfulness and range of motion while improving balance and body awareness Find your zen while receiving all of the tranquility that the water has to offer

As You Choose

Participants are free to choose to work out in the deep water wearing a flotation belt or in the shallow water with their feet on the floor With careful attention and preparation, the instructor is able to teach to all participants .

Deep Water Workout

Wearing a floatation belt, you submerge yourself in the deep end of a pool for a deep water workout! While your deep water aerobics class has a low impact on your joints, it has an enormous impact on your cardiovascular system with the help of the resistance in the water . Class formats may vary between Tabata, circuit, boot camp or interval .

Shallow Water Workout

Activate your aqua urge for exercise! This class is held in the pool’s shallow end in chest-deep water so your feet are always touching the floor . Shallow water workouts improve agility, coordination, flexibility and cardiovascular endurance Equipment may be used to develop strength and balance .

Tether Deep Water Workout

Aquafit enthusiasts will benefit from this fun cardiovascular workout in the deep water! There is a strong focus on core stability while performing deep water moves which will result in increased intensity Participants will find themselves tethered to a lane rope with a bungee cord attached to a belt Great for beginner to advanced!

PWR! Moves

Designed for people with Parkinson’s, this program assists to mitigate symptoms and rebuild mobility and functionality The skills we teach can be practiced in multiple positions, can be made progressively more physically and cognitively challenging, and can be altered to target each person’s unique symptoms .

A one time assessment is required prior to enrolment. Approximately 1 .5 hours in duration, the assessment covers varying balance tests as well as a six-minute walk test . It also includes two complimentary classes Assessment Fee: $49
